COMIC STRIP DEBUTED ON THIS DAY IN 1930

The comic strip Blondie has been published by King Features Syndicate in
newspapers around the country since Monday, September 8, 1930. The strip
features Blondie Bumstead and her sandwich-loving husband Dagwood. Chic
Young (below) drew Blondie until his death in 1973, and the duties were then
passed on to his son Dean Young, who continues to write the strip today. The
strip has remained popular, appearing in more than 2,000 newspapers in 47
countries and translated into 35 languages.

COMIC STRIP DEBUTED ON THIS DAY IN 1934

The comic strip Li’l Abner featured a clan of hillbillies in the town of Dogpatch,
Kentucky. The strip was written and drawn by Al Capp (below) and ran for 43
years, from  August 13, 1934 through November 13, 1977. It was distributed
by United Features Syndicate to many newspa[ers throught the United States,
Canada and Europe and was read by millions of people.

Tony Bennett (born Anthony Dominick Benedetto) began singing at an
early age. He later fought in the final stages of World War ll as a U.S. Army
infantryman in Europe. Upon returning to civilian life Bennett developed his
singing skills and soon signed with Columbia Records where he had his first
number one song  with “Because of You” in 1951. In 1962, Bennett recorded
his famous signature song, “I Left My Heart In San Francisco”. Bennett is also
a serious and accomplished painter, creating works under the name Benedetto.

REMBRANDT REMEMBERED

Rembrandt4

                  July 15, 1606 – October 4, 1669

Rembrandt Harmenszoon van Rijn was a Dutch painter and etcher who
is generally considered one of the greatest painters and printmakers in
European art history and the most important in Dutch history, a period
historians call the Dutch Golden Age.
